Express Deployment Tool (EDT)

To help our system builder partners quickly, easily, and correctly deploy PCs with Windows 7, Windows Server 2008 R2, Office 2010, PC Essentials, Microsoft Security Essentials, and Internet Explorer 9 Microsoft has developed the Express Deployment Tool (EDT).

Speed Through Preinstallation and Deployment

The traditional OPKs for Windows and Office contain a wealth of technical information to address numerous scenarios; they are designed to meet the needs of the wide range of OEMs who build PCs. The Express Deployment Tool (EDT) works with OEM Preinstallation Kit (OPK) tools to provide streamlined deployments of typical PC configurations.

The Express Deployment Tool (EDT) makes it easier to install software quickly, and create a consistent and customized end-user experience.

With its wizard-based interface and simplified process of preinstallation, the EDT is designed to help system builders realize all the benefits of the traditional OPK in a fraction of the time.

Using the EDT to set up the Reference PC takes approximately 1 - 2 hours. Once the Reference PC has been created, centralized deployment of any image onto new PCs takes less than 10 minutes.

To run the Express Deployment Tool, you will need the OPK tools and the bits for the software that you want to install.

If you downloaded the EDT prior to June 30, we recommend that you upgrade to version 1.1.0 now.

EDT version 1.1.0 is available for download in English. The tool is expected to be available for additional languages in November 2011.

Express Deployment Tool version 1.1.0 supports system builder preinstallation of:

  • Windows 7
  • Service Pack 1 for Windows 7
  • Windows Server 2008 R2
  • Microsoft Office 2010
  • PC Essentials
  • Microsoft Security Essentials
  • Internet Explorer 9 (32-bit and 64-bit)
  • Remote update and notification (automatic update of the EDT)

EDT version 1.1.0 also includes the following improvements:

  • Removed EULA requirement if Windows Live Essentials is added to the image
  • Fixed the “no drive selected” error during Windows 7 Copy process
  • Added <UserAgent>MASB</UserAgent> to AutoUnattend.xml
